India Joins U.S.-Led Pax Silica Alliance for Critical Minerals and AI Resilience
NEW DELHI – India officially joined the U.S.-led Pax Silica initiative on Friday, February 20, 2026. This strategic alliance aims to build resilient global supply chains. It focuses on critical minerals and artificial intelligence. Union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w and U.S. Ambassador to India Sergio Gor signed the declaration. U.S. Under Secretary of State for Economic Affairs Jacob Helberg also attended the ceremony. India’s entry marks a significant step. It strengthens cooperation in advanced technology sectors.
A New Era of Tech Cooperation
Pax Silica launched in December 2025. It is the U.S. Department of State’s flagship effort. The initiative fosters a new economic security consensus. It brings together allies and trusted partners. The goal is to secure the future of AI and semiconductor supply chains. It specifically targets critical minerals. The 21st century runs on compute power. This power requires essential minerals. The initiative ensures these supply chains are secure. Therefore, it combats potential vulnerabilities.

India’s Growing Role
Union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w emphasized India’s ambitions. He noted the country’s progress in semiconductor design. Indian engineers are designing advanced 2-nanometer chips. The semiconductor industry needs skilled workers. India is poised to supply this talent. Vaishnaw stated that India aims for global leadership. This applies to the semiconductor and electronics industries. Pax Silica will significantly benefit India’s electronics sector. The initiative will also foster a complete ecosystem in India. Building a Trusted Tech Ecosystem
The Pax Silica initiative covers the entire technology supply chain. This includes critical minerals and energy. It spans advanced manufacturing and AI infrastructure. It also encompasses logistics and trusted digital systems. The coalition aims to build secure, resilient, and innovation-driven supply chains. It replaces coercive dependencies with positive-sum alliances. Nations committed to open markets and democratic values are key. Pax Silica seeks to counter China’s dominance. It addresses vulnerabilities from concentrated supply chains.
